Trelasarra, Moon Dancer stands as a distinctive legendary creature within the Magic: The Gathering trading card game, specifically originating from the 2021 Adventures in the Forgotten Realms expansion. Identified by card number 236, this uncommon card brings a unique combination of Elf and Cleric subtypes that appeals to collectors and players alike. The card features a mana cost of {G}{W} and boasts a mana value of 2, positioning it as an accessible early-game presence on the battlefield. As a Legendary Creature with a power and toughness of 2/2, Trelasarra offers strategic depth through its activated ability. Whenever a player gains life, this card triggers a dual effect: it puts a +1/+1 counter on itself and allows the player to scry 1. Scrying enables the player to look at the top card of their library and optionally place it on the bottom, providing valuable card selection and deck filtering capabilities. This mechanic makes the card a functional asset in decks focused on life gain strategies, adding versatility to gameplay. The artistic vision for this card was brought to life by artist Kieran Yanner, whose work is celebrated in the Magic: The Gathering community. The flavor text, referencing the deity Eilistraee, adds narrative depth, emphasizing themes of beauty, light, and personal agency. These elements combine to create a card that is not only mechanically interesting but also rich in lore, making it a desirable addition for fans of the Forgotten Realms setting. Card Text
Abilities, attacks, oracle text, and flavor text printed on the card.
Whenever you gain life, put a +1/+1 counter on Trelasarra and scry 1. (Look at the top card of your library. You may put that card on the bottom.)
"Eilistraee teaches us that we are not bound by the circumstances of our birth. We all may find beauty and light, if we have the courage to seek them."
